Resume Writing Tips

  • β†’Highlight specific climate modeling tools you've used, such as MATLAB or R.
  • β†’Include any fieldwork experience, especially in diverse geographic locations.
  • β†’Emphasize publications or presentations at climate science conferences.
  • β†’Showcase interdisciplinary projects that demonstrate your collaboration skills.
  • β†’Mention any direct impact your research has had on climate policy or adaptation strategies.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• βœ•Failing to quantify your achievements and impact in previous roles.
  • βœ•Listing generic skills instead of ones specific to climate research methodologies.
  • βœ•Neglecting to mention important collaborations with external stakeholders or organizations.
  • βœ•Omitting ongoing education or certifications relevant to climate science.

Climate Research Scientist Career Path

Relevant Certifications

Certified Climate Change Professional (CC-P)National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ration (NOAA) trainingIntergovernmental Panel on Climate Change (IPCC) certified courses

Career Progression

Entry-level Climate Research Scientist

Assists in data collection and preliminary analysis under the supervision of senior researchers.

Mid-level Climate Research Scientist

Conducts independent research projects, develops algorithms to analyze climate data, and collaborates with interdisciplinary teams.

Senior Climate Research Scientist

Leads significant research initiatives, mentors junior scientists, and publishes findings in prominent journals.

Lead Research Scientist

Oversees climate research strategy, manages funding applications, and engages with stakeholders in governmental and non-profit sectors.

Director of Climate Research

Directs all research activities, sets long-term research goals, and represents the organization in international climate discussions.

About the Climate Research Scientist Role

A Climate Research Scientist investigates atmospheric and environmental changes to inform strategies that combat climate change. This role involves utilizing advanced modeling techniques and analyzing large datasets to predict climate trends. Collaboration with policy makers and stakeholders is crucial to translate scientific findings into actionable solutions for climate-related issues.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the typical career progression for a Climate Research Scientist? +

Starting from entry-level positions, one can advance to mid-level roles, and with experience, potentially become a lead scientist or director.

Do I need to pursue a PhD to become a Climate Research Scientist? +

While a PhD is common and beneficial for advanced research roles, some positions may only require a master's degree with relevant experience.

What kind of research do Climate Research Scientists typically conduct? +

Research may involve analyzing climate data, modeling climate scenarios, and assessing the impact of climate policies.

What skills are most valued in a Climate Research Scientist? +

Technical skills in data analysis, proficiency in climate modeling software, and strong communication skills are essential.

Is field research important for Climate Research Scientists? +

Field research can be critical, as it provides real-world data that complements modeling efforts.

How can I improve my chances of being hired as a Climate Research Scientist? +

Gaining diverse experiences, networking within the climate science community, and securing relevant internships can significantly enhance your profile.
